The Science Behind Polarized Lenses

We’ve all heard of polarized lenses, but do you know how they work? Polarized lenses are special lenses that are designed to reduce glare by blocking certain types of light. Polarized lenses can be found in sunglasses, camera filters, and in some cases, specialized eyeglasses. In this blog, we’ll explore the science behind polarized lenses and how they work to reduce glare. Polarized lenses are designed to reduce glare by blocking certain types of light. Light is made up of waves, and these waves have a specific orientation. When light reflects off of a flat surface, the waves become oriented in the same direction. This is called “polarization”, and it causes the light to become much brighter. Designed to block this type of light, reducing glare and making it easier to see. Uncover the right style for you!

When it comes to choosing the right sunglasses for your face shape, it can be a daunting task. With so many different styles, shapes and sizes to choose from, it’s hard to know which ones will flatter your face and make you look your best. Fortunately, there are a few tips that can help you pick out the perfect sunglasses for your face shape. The first step is to determine your face shape. Generally, there are four main face shapes: oval, round, heart and oblong. To figure out which shape you have, take a look in the mirror and pay attention to the width of your forehead, cheekbones, and jawline. Once you’ve determined your face shape, it’s time to find the right sunglasses for it. Oval face shape - (Round/Cat Eye/Rectangle/Wayfarer/Square/Aviator/Geometric/Oval) You’re lucky because practically any style of sunglasses will look great on you. Aviators Coming Back in Fashion

Aviators were popular in the 1920s and originally worn by pilots in the 1930s. A classic style of sunglasses that have withstood the test of time. With their large lenses and thin frames, aviators can add a touch of sophistication to any outfit. And yes, aviators are coming back in fashion! There are many different types of aviators to choose from, so let’s take a closer look at some of the most popular styles.   Classic Teardrop A classic teardrop aviator sunglass is a style of sunglasses that has round lenses, a thin metal frame, and a curved brow bar. The lenses are usually large and often have a slightly green or brown tint to them. The frame is typically made of lightweight metal, such as silver or gold, and often has a double-bridge design.
